§ 36:2-362 — Annual observance.
New Jersey·Title 36 LEGAL HOLIDAYS
2.The Governor is requested to annually issue a proclamation calling upon public officials, private organizations, and all citizens and residents of this State to observe the month by patronizing small businesses, as well as engaging in appropriate activities and programs designed to support small businesses across the State. L.2019, J.R.13, s.2.
